Your credit score serves as your financial fingerprint, influencing a wide array of your financial life. While you need to consider many factors at the beginning of the financial year like tax planning, budgeting, and applying for loans that meet your needs, you should not forget to manage your credit score effectively.

For those with an existing credit score, it can affect everything from securing loans and mortgages to determining interest rates and insurance premiums. For 'new to credit' customers who have never applied for a loan or credit card before, establishing a positive credit history is crucial. Much like the start of a new calendar year symbolises fresh beginnings and resolutions, the onset of FY25 presents an excellent opportunity to reassess one's approach to credit management and make proactive changes.

Initiating a credit journey

Building a credit score is important for everyone, but especially for people who are new to credit. The first step is to understand how to start building a credit history which will then help you develop a credit score. A strong credit score offers myriad advantages that extend far beyond simple borrowing capabilities.
